- Hayride/campfire series gets going at multiple parks -
  

BROWARD COUNTY, FL - The temperatures may not feel fall-like yet, but you can go all autumnal at multiple parks during our 2021-2022 Family Hayride & Campfire Series. Schedules vary by park, but they're all from 6:30 to 9PM and cost $4/person for ages 3 and up. That includes one hayride through the park and a bag of goodies to make s'mores with around the campfire afterward.

The events are on Fridays everywhere but Markham, where they're on Saturdays (the park's weekend gate fee of $1.50/person, ages 5 and under free, will also be in effect).

Preregistration and prepayment are required, either at the park office or by visiting WebTrac.Broward.org.

About the Parks and Recreation Division
Broward County Parks manages almost 6,500 acres, encompassing nearly 50 regional parks and nature centers, neighborhood parks, and natural areas at various stages of development.
